To begin, it’s essential to understand the unique charm of Yixing. The city is home to the famous Yixing Purple Clay Pottery, which has been crafted for over 1,500 years. This art form is not only a symbol of Yixing’s cultural identity but also a major attraction for visitors. Additionally, Yixing is surrounded by beautiful natural scenery, including the scenic Yixing Mountains and the tranquil Zhushan Lake. These natural attractions offer the perfect backdrop for relaxation and exploration.
Planning a Yixing tour involves several key steps. First, decide on the duration of your trip. A typical visit can range from one to three days, depending on your interests. If you’re a first-time visitor, a two-day itinerary is ideal, allowing you to cover the main attractions without feeling rushed. Next, create a list of must-see sites. These include the Yixing Purple Clay Pottery Museum, the Zhushan Tea Culture Museum, and the Yixing Mountains. Don’t forget to visit the traditional tea plantations and experience the local tea culture firsthand.
Once you have your itinerary, it’s important to plan your transportation. Yixing has a well-developed public transportation system, including buses and taxis, making it easy to get around. However, if you want more flexibility, renting a car is a great option. This allows you to explore the surrounding areas at your own pace. Additionally, consider booking a guided tour for a more in-depth experience, especially if you’re interested in the history and culture of Yixing.
Another key aspect of planning a Yixing tour is accommodation. The city offers a wide range of options, from budget-friendly hostels to luxury hotels. For a more authentic experience, consider staying in one of the traditional Yixing-style houses, which provide a unique glimpse into local life. If you’re looking for a more modern stay, the city center has several high-end hotels with excellent amenities.
To make the most of your visit, it’s also helpful to plan your meals. Yixing is known for its delicious local cuisine, particularly its tea-related dishes and traditional snacks. Be sure to try the famous Yixing tea, which is grown in the surrounding tea plantations. Local markets and street food stalls are great places to sample the flavors of Yixing.
To give you a clearer idea of what to expect, let’s look at a sample itinerary for a two-day visit. On the first day, start your tour at the Yixing Purple Clay Pottery Museum, where you can learn about the history and craftsmanship of this unique art form. Afterward, visit the Zhushan Tea Culture Museum to explore the rich tea culture of Yixing. In the afternoon, take a short trip to the nearby tea plantations and enjoy a tea tasting session.
On the second day, head to the Yixing Mountains for a scenic hike. The mountains offer breathtaking views and a peaceful environment for relaxation. In the evening, return to the city center and enjoy a traditional Yixing meal at one of the local restaurants. This itinerary allows you to experience the best of Yixing’s culture, art, and nature.
